Ceremonies held across the country, but main funeral was in Kocani, where 30 victims were buried.Thousands of mourners have flocked to funerals in North Macedonia for the dozens of victims of last weekend’s devastating nightclub fire. The fire broke out during a concert by the hip-hop duo DNK at the Pulse nightclub in the town of Kocani about 3am (02:00 GMT) on Sunday when sparks from flares set the ceiling alight. A United States citizen abducted by the Taliban has been released after two years in captivity, according to the US Department of State. The release on Thursday of George Glezmann, who was abducted while travelling as a tourist in Afghanistan in December 2022, marks the third time a US detainee has been freed by the Taliban since January. In a statement, Secretary of State Marco Rubio said Glezmann’s release represents a “positive and constructive step”.
